Double hung window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new units that feature a traditional design with two movable sashes. This type of window allows for easy opening and closing from both the top and bottom, providing versatile ventilation options. The process typically includes measuring the window opening, selecting the appropriate replacement units, and carefully installing them to ensure a proper fit and function. Skilled contractors focus on minimizing disruption and ensuring the new windows operate smoothly, enhancing both the appearance and performance of a home’s exterior.

These services are especially helpful for addressing common iss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ing existing windows, or broken window parts that compromise energy efficiency and security. Over time, older windows can become less effective at insulating a home, leading to higher energy bills and less comfort during extreme weather. Replacement can also eliminate problems like rattling, sticking sashes, or cracked glass, providing a more reliable and secure window solution. The overview below groups typical Double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Abilene,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or double hung window repairs in Abilene range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ve replacing sashes, hardware, or sealing issues and are common for routine maintenance.

Standard Replacement - Full window replacements usually fall between $600 and $1,200 per window. Many local contractors handle these mid-range projects efficiently,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Multi-Unit Projects - Replacing multiple windows in a single property can cost between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the number of windows and complexity.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range but are less common.

Custom or High-End Installations - Premium double hung window replacements with special features or high-end materials can cost $2,000 or more per window. These projects are typically less frequent but represent the upper tier of potential costs in the area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are double hung windows? Double hung windows are a type of window with two vertically sliding sashes that can move independently, allowing for versatile ventilation and easy cleaning.

Why consider replacing old double hung windows? Replacing outdated double hung wind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, and update the appearance of a property.

What signs indicate the need for double hung window replacement? Signs include difficulty opening or closing the window, drafts, condensation between panes, or visible damage to the frame or sash.

How do local contractors handle double hung window replacements? Local service providers typically assess the existing openings, select suitable replacement windows, and professionally install them to ensure proper operation and fit.

What benefits can new double hung windows offer? New double hung windows can provide improved insulation, easier maintenance, and a refreshed look for the home or building.
